# Choose the target layer you want to compute the visualization for.
# Usually this will be the last convolutional layer in the model.
# Some common choices can be:
# Resnet18 and 50: model.layer4
# VGG, densenet161: model.features[-1]
# mnasnet1_0: model.layers[-1]
# You can print the model to help chose the layer
# You can pass a list with several target layers,
# in that case the CAMs will be computed per layer and then aggregated.
# You can also try selecting all layers of a certain type, with e.g:
# from pytorch_grad_cam.utils.find_layers import find_layer_types_recursive
# find_layer_types_recursive(model, [torch.nn.ReLU])
target_layers = [model.layers[3]]
